- Accept the risk, with or without a contingency plan.
- Transfer the risk to someone else - e.g. outsouce.
- Avoid the risk e.g. do something different
- Mitigation of Impact - take steps to reduce the impact of the risk if were to happen
- Mitigation of Probability - take steps to reduce the probability of a risk occuring
